Abstract

The application provides a but fixed drainage catheter device in retractable, it includes: the drainage tube comprises a drainage tube body, a balloon, an elastic fixing tube and a fixing sleeve; the balloon is formed into a hollow structure by elastic materials and is fixed at the first end of the drainage tube body; forming a plurality of side holes along the periphery of the balloon, and forming a top hole at the first end of the balloon; the saccule is communicated with the drainage tube body through a side hole and a top hole of the saccule; the elastic fixing tube is made of hard elastic material, and the cross section of the elastic fixing tube is of a C-shaped structure; the elastic fixing tube is sleeved on the drainage tube body; the fixing sleeve is formed into a cylinder shape and can be sleeved on the drainage tube body in a sliding way; the retainer sleeve is adapted to fit over the second end of the flexible retainer tube to maintain its compressed shape when the flexible retainer tube is compressed and becomes smaller in diameter.

Retractable internal fixation drainage catheter device
Technical Field
The application relates to a medical instrument, in particular to a retractable internal fixation drainage catheter device.
Background
The drainage tube is a medical appliance for clinical surgery drainage, which guides pus, blood and liquid accumulated in human tissues or body cavities to the outside of the body, prevents postoperative infection and promotes wound healing. A drainage tube passing through a chest wall or an abdominal wall, which is easily pulled and accidentally comes off due to inconvenient fixation; in addition, the current drainage tube is a single opening and is easily blocked.

Detailed Description
A retractable internally fixed drainage catheter device of the present application will be described in detail with reference to the accompanying drawings.
The application discloses but fixed drainage catheter device in retractable, it includes: a drainage tube body 2, a balloon 4, an elastic fixing tube 3 and a fixing sleeve 1;
the balloon 4 is formed into a hollow structure by an elastic material (such as medical silicon rubber) and is fixed at the first end of the drainage tube body 2; forming a plurality of side holes 5 along the periphery of the balloon 4, and forming a top hole 6 at a first end of the balloon 4; the saccule 4 is communicated with the drainage tube body through a side hole 5 and a top hole 6 of the saccule for drainage; the porous structure of the side holes 5 and the top holes 6 does not influence the drainage of other holes of the drainage tube even if one hole is blocked.
The elastic fixing tube 3 is made of hard elastic material (medical metal or hard plastic), the cross section of the elastic fixing tube is of a C-shaped structure, and as shown in fig. 3, two ends of the elastic fixing tube are staggered so as to be conveniently changed into a round tube with a smaller diameter when compressed. The elastic fixing tube 3 is sleeved on the drainage tube body 2.
The fixing sleeve 1 is formed into a cylinder shape and can be sleeved on the drainage tube body 2 in a sliding way; the fixing sleeve 1 is used to be fitted over the second end of the elastic fixing tube 3 to maintain its compressed shape when the elastic fixing tube 3 is compressed to be reduced in diameter.
The second end of the balloon 4 forms a guide ramp to facilitate its reception in the resilient fixation tube 3.
Before the drainage tube body is arranged, the saccule is arranged in the compressed elastic fixing tube, as shown in figure 5, and the second end of the compressed elastic fixing tube is sleeved by the fixing sleeve at the moment so as to keep the compressed shape; after being compressed, the two staggered ends of the elastic fixing tube are overlapped, one is positioned at the inner side, and the other is positioned at the outer side, so that the elastic fixing tube becomes a tube with smaller diameter and is suitable for being inserted into a hole on the chest wall or the abdominal wall; then, the fixing sleeve is taken down, and the elastic fixing tube is released, so that the saccule contained in the elastic fixing tube can be easily pushed out; at the moment, if the elastic fixing tube can be directly pulled out from the hole, the elastic fixing tube is directly pulled out, and if the elastic fixing tube is not easy to directly pull out, the elastic fixing tube is compressed again and sleeved by a fixing sleeve and then pulled out.
The process of taking out the drainage tube body is opposite to the process of putting in the drainage tube body; as shown in fig. 6, the elastic fixing tube is first compressed and inserted into the hole of the chest or abdominal wall 7, then the fixing sheath is removed to open the elastic fixing tube, the balloon is withdrawn into the elastic fixing tube, then the elastic fixing tube is compressed again and fixed by the fixing sheath, and finally the elastic fixing tube and the balloon are withdrawn together.
